Ather Rizta vs Bajaj Chetak: Which Electric Scooter Should You Buy?

Scooter Compare | Jul 16, 2025 | Posted By: Aditi

The Ather Rizta is the first family-oriented electric scooter from Ather Energy. It is designed with a strong focus on comfort, functionality for daily use and is available in a variety of colours. Alternatively, the Bajaj Chetak, with its unique retro styling and monocoque chassis, is one of the highest-selling electric scooters in the market. The Rizta strives more towards innovation and utility, whereas the Chetak is for anybody who wants a classic look with the electric concept.

Here's a more detailed comparison:

Pricing and variants

  • The Ather Rizta starts at a higher ex-showroom price than the Bajaj Chetak.
  • Chetak has more variants than the Rizta. Rizta has two; meanwhile, the Chetak comes with three variants, each getting two battery packs.
  • The Rizta comes in various battery capacities (2.9 kWh and 3.7 kWh), resulting in differing prices among its models.
  • The Chetak also has versions with varying battery capacities (3 kWh and 3.5 kWh).

Performance Comparison

Top Speed

  • Ather Rizta: 80 km/h
  • Bajaj Chetak: Up to 73 km/h (varies by variant)

Range (per charge)

  • Rizta: 123 km to 159 km, depending on the variant
  • Chetak: 151 km to 153 km, depending on the variant

Power Output

  • Rizta: 4.3 kW peak motor power
  • Chetak: 3.1 kW peak motor power

Features and Design

Ather Rizta

  • A family scooter with a focus on space and utility
  • Long, cushioned seat with wide pillion backrest
  • 34L storage under-seat with added frunk option for additional luggage
  • Smart connectivity options: Bluetooth, navigation, app support
  • Safety measures such as skid control and emergency stop signal
  • Fitted with a 7.0-inch TFT display

Bajaj Chetak

  • Unique with a metal body and premium finish
  • Has Eco and Sport riding modes
  • Fitted with front and rear disc brakes, LED lighting, and sequential indicators
  • App connectivity is offered on some versions
  • Includes adequate under-seat storage, although slightly less than the Rizta's

Charging

Ather Rizta: Charging time varies with variant and battery size—with a maximum of 8 hr 30 mins (largest pack/standard charging speed).

Bajaj Chetak: Provides a combination of fast charging and standard 5A home socket charging, with overall charge time differing for different variants.

The final choice between Ather Rizta and Bajaj Chetak depends on your priorities.

  • Choose Ather Rizta if comfortable riding, practicality, safety, and a slightly higher top speed are what you choose over the extra price.
  • Choose Bajaj Chetak if you want a classic design, sturdy finish, and a tested range—and don't mind compromising on top speed or bonuses like under-seat storage.

It's a good idea to test both scooters and compare the features and specs of the particular variants on which you have fixed your gaze before making the final choice.
